Staff Engineer I, AI, Java
Posted 7hrs ago
Employment Information
Report this job
Job expired or something wrong with this job?
Job Description
Staff Engineer I developing Java-based backend services and AI-enabled solutions for Cotiviti. Leading engineering teams to deliver secure, scalable services across enterprise workflow platforms.
Responsibilities:
- Lead design and development of Java-based backend services (Spring Boot, microservices)
- Implement solutions across workflow platforms (Temporal, Camunda, Flowable, JBPM, Drools, Appian)
- Build AI-enabled service capabilities for workflow automation and decision support
- Drive adoption of AI-assisted development (Claude, Copilot) with strong validation and engineering standards
- Implement AI-native patterns : intelligent routing context-aware processing embedded decision support
- Lead microservices and event-driven architectures for scalable systems
- Collaborate with architects to translate design into implementation
- Provide technical leadership: design/code reviews mentoring engineers guiding best practices
- Support CI/CD, DevSecOps, and cloud deployments (OpenShift, Kubernetes, AWS)
- Drive reusable services and shared platform components
Requirements:
- Bachelor’s degree in Computer Science or equivalent
- 8–10+ years of enterprise backend development experience
- Strong expertise in: Java, Spring Boot, microservices, REST APIs and integration patterns
- Workflow orchestration platforms
- Experience integrating AI-driven capabilities into enterprise systems
- Strong understanding of distributed systems and event-driven architecture
- Experience with: PostgreSQL / Oracle, CI/CD, DevOps, OpenShift, Kubernetes, AWS
- Familiarity with Copilot, Claude or similar tools
- Proven ability to lead design, mentor engineers, and drive alignment
Benefits:
- medical, dental, vision, disability, and life insurance coverage
- 401(k) savings plans
- paid family leave
- 9 paid holidays per year
- 17-27 days of Paid Time Off (PTO) per year













